    Rohde & Schwarz Mobile Test Summit on trends in wireless communications – sessions available online now

    This year’s Mobile Test Summit occurred from November 28 to November 29, 2023. Wireless communications professionals came to the Rohde & Schwarz headquarters in Munich for two days of insights into the latest developments in mobile device and infrastructure testing. The event explored a wide range of topics, with a focus on the next wave of 5G and early 6G: non-terrestrial networks (NTN), reduced capability (RedCap), mission-critical communications (MCx), terahertz (THz), spectrum for 6G, metaverse and XR. Other important topics were the latest advancements in broadband technologies (such as Wi-Fi 7), Open Radio Access Networks (O-RAN), advanced multiple input multiple output (MIMO) and beamforming.

    For those interested in these topics but unable to join in person, Rohde & Schwarz offers on-demand recordings of all the presentations. The international speaker line-up includes leading IoT companies, O-RAN suppliers, chip manufacturers and satellite communications service providers:

    • Lars Wehmeier and Volker Breuer from Telit Cinterion on expanding IoT devices and their uses with 5G RedCap
    • Harald Ludwig from Arico Technologies on MCx
    • Adrian O’Connor from Benetel on O-RAN
    • Peadar Forbes from Analog Devices on critical design considerations for massive MIMO and beamforming
    • Marko Keskinen from Skylo Technologies on direct-to-device satellite connectivity
    • Tilo Heckmann from Telefonica Germany on NTN operator perspective
    • Marco Guadalupi from Sateliot on 5G NB-IoT NTN coverage extension
    • Sandro Scalise from the German Aerospace Center on resilient 3D networks
    • Hans Joachim Schulze from Vodafone on conformance testing
    • Michael Grundl from LANCOM on Wi-Fi 6E and Wi-Fi 7

    Alexander Pabst, Vice President of Wireless Communications at Rohde & Schwarz, says, “Rapid advancements in the mobile ecosystem make it vital to address testing challenges. This year’s Mobile Test Summit provided a platform for truly meaningful dialogue on the latest developments in wireless communications. Our recordings of the event provide a window into two days of lively discussion, offering curated insights from industry leaders and Rohde & Schwarz technology experts.”
